BREAKING: New York City parking garage collapses, leaving multiple people injured, trapped

Firefighters inspect the site of a garage collapse at 37 Ann Street in New York City, Tuesday, April 18, 2023.

The office of Mayor Eric Adams said the mayor was briefed on the partial collapse and was headed over to the scene. This is a developing story. Check back for updates. Get all the stories you need-to-know from the most powerful name in news delivered first thing every morning to your inbox
